Union City-Forrest Christmas Raid

December 21, 1862
Obion County

As part of the extended raid against Union supply lines in WestTennessee, Confederate cavalry under Brig. Gen. Nathan Bedford Forrest forced a surrender of the Federal garrison at Union City, Tennessee commanded by Capt. Samuel B. Logan (54 th Illinois Infantry) on December 21, 1862.
